技术文摘
2020 年 8 个值得关注的优秀 Node.js 框架
2024-12-31 09:23:22 小编
2020 年 8 个值得关注的优秀 Node.js 框架
在当今的 Web 开发领域,Node.js 凭借其高效、灵活和可扩展性,成为了众多开发者的首选。而众多的 Node.js 框架更是为开发工作提供了强大的支持和便利。以下为您介绍 2020 年 8 个值得关注的优秀 Node.js 框架。
首先是 Express 框架,它是 Node.js 中最常用的 Web 应用框架之一,具有简洁、灵活的特点,非常适合构建小型到中型的 Web 应用。
Next.js 框架则专注于服务器渲染和静态生成,为开发者提供了出色的性能和优化的用户体验,尤其适用于构建高性能的单页应用。
Koa 框架基于异步函数,相较于传统的回调方式,代码更加简洁易读,提供了更优雅的中间件处理方式。
Nest.js 框架受到了 Angular 的启发,采用了模块化和面向对象的编程风格,使得大型项目的架构更加清晰和易于维护。
Fastify 框架以其出色的性能而闻名,它注重高效的路由处理和数据解析,能够快速处理大量并发请求。
Meteor 框架是一个全栈框架,它将客户端和服务器端的开发统一起来,大大提高了开发效率。
Sails.js 框架提供了强大的数据模型和 ORM 支持,使得数据库操作变得简单直观。
最后是 Adonis.js 框架,它具有丰富的功能和完善的文档,为开发者提供了一个稳定可靠的开发环境。
这 8 个 Node.js 框架各有特色,能够满足不同类型项目和开发者的需求。在选择框架时,应根据项目的具体需求、团队的技术栈以及框架的特点进行综合考虑。无论您是开发小型项目还是大型企业应用,总有一款框架能够助您一臂之力,让您的 Node.js 开发之旅更加顺畅和高效。
- Ubuntu 系统安装游戏通讯应用 Mumble 教程
- CentOS7 图形化配置网络的方式
- Ubuntu 中 Python.h: 无文件或目录的解决之道
- Ubuntu 系统中 Pure-ftpd 的安装与配置指南
- Ubuntu 系统中网络服务与该版本网络管理器的不兼容解决之道
- Ubuntu 服务器升级至 14.04LTS 版本的办法
- CentOS7.0 中 Scala 和 Sun JDK 的安装方法
- Ubuntu 15.04 系统安装完成后的 15 件事
- CentOS 7 中 DNS+DHCP 动态更新的实现详解
- 在 CentOS 6.6 中安装 GreenPlum 4.3.5.2 的方法
- CentOS7 实现默认登录界面改为字符界面的途径
- CentOS 文件通配符解析
- 虚拟内存扩展的方法指南
- Linux 系统中 Ubuntu/Deepin 桌面登录管理器的更换方法
- 详解 yum 与 apt-get 的区别